  1. Mick Ronson starb am 29. April 1993 im Alter von nur 46 Jahren an Leberkrebs. Insbesondere in seiner Heimatstadt Hull ist er unvergessen, dort wurde ihm zu Ehren eine Bühne, die „Mick Ronson Memorial Stage“, errichtet. Der Rolling Stone listete Ronson 2011 auf Rang 41 der 100 größten Gitarristen aller Zeiten.

    The Mick Ronson Memorial Stage in 2007. Ronson died of liver cancer on 29 April 1993, aged 46. On 6 May, his funeral was held in a Mormon chapel in London, as he had been raised in the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ints. In his memory, the Mick Ronson Memorial Stage was constructed in Queen's Gardens, Hull.
